What a find! The best pub grub I’ve come across for years and not astronomically priced either like most places these days. We did a lovely little loop from the village car park, up past the reservoir, over Embsay crag and looped back across the moors back to the village and straight into the pub. We left our dog in the car as she was filthy but did note a few happy dogs down at the bottom of the pub. Out of respect we swiftly removed our boots too so as not to trail mud through the place. Noted the polite notice on the door too. Samira opted for the veg lasagna and I ordered the steak pie. DELICIOUS! We will be back!

Nice example of a traditional country pub. Popped in after a mid week walk round the reservoir hoping to get lunch. Unfortunately they had stopped serving so settled for a quick pint before afternoon closing at 3pm, just like the old days. I'm normally a dark ale drinker but given a choice of Hetton Pale, and Taylor's Golden Best or Knowle Spring I chose the latter. I must say it was exceptional, with that unique flavour that all Taylor's ales had before Landlord became the mass produced beer found all over the country that it has become.
